Core Financial Concepts Every Digital Currency Trader Should Master

Before diving into specific strategies, traders must understand foundational financial principles:

1. Budgeting and Capital Allocation

Effective trading begins with disciplined capital management.

  • Set an investment budget: Only trade with money you can afford to lose.
  • Diversify your portfolio: Avoid putting all funds into a single cryptocurrency.
  • Use a trading plan: Define your risk tolerance, profit targets, and stop-loss levels.

2. Risk Management Strategies

Crypto markets are notoriously volatile. Proper risk management can protect your capital.

  • Use stop-loss and take-profit orders to control losses and lock in gains.
  • Limit leverage usage: While leverage can amplify gains, it also increases losses exponentially.
  • Implement position sizing techniques: Only risk a small percentage of your capital per trade, typically 1-2%.

3. Understanding Market Indicators and Data Analysis

Technical analysis is central to crypto trading.

  • Learn to interpret candlestick charts, volume data, and moving averages.
  • Use fundamental indicators, such as network activity, adoption rates, or regulatory news, to inform long-term decisions.
  • Keep abreast of market sentiment through news outlets, social media, and trading forums.

Advanced Financial Literacy Tips for Digital Currency Traders

Once the basics are mastered, traders should focus on more advanced areas:

4. Taxation and Legal Compliance

Crypto taxation varies by country and can be complex.

  • Keep detailed records of all transactions.
  • Understand how capital gains taxes apply to your jurisdiction.
  • Consult with tax professionals specializing in cryptocurrencies.

5. Protecting Your Assets

Security is paramount in crypto trading.

  • Use hardware wallets or secure cold storage solutions.
  • Enable two-factor authentication on exchange accounts.
  • Beware of phishing scams and suspicious links.

6. Psychological Discipline and Emotional Control

Trading can evoke strong emotions like fear or greed.

  • Maintain a trading journal to analyze behaviors and decisions.
  • Stick to your trading plan, regardless of market hype.
  • Practice mindfulness and avoid impulsive trades.

Learn to Manage Risks and Rewards in Crypto Trading

Balancing potential gains with associated risks is a critical skill.

Strategies include:

  • Diversifying across multiple cryptos.
  • Using risk/reward ratios to evaluate trades.
  • Only engaging in trades where the potential reward justifies the risk.
